| # This file provides the language dependent support in the main Makefile. |
| # Each language makefile fragment must provide the following targets: |
| # |
| # foo.all.build, foo.all.cross, foo.start.encap, foo.rest.encap, |
| # foo.info, foo.dvi, |
| # foo.install-normal, foo.install-common, foo.install-info, foo.install-man, |
| # foo.uninstall, foo.distdir, |
| # foo.mostlyclean, foo.clean, foo.distclean, foo.extraclean, |
| # foo.maintainer-clean, foo.stage1, foo.stage2, foo.stage3, foo.stage4 |
| # |
| # where `foo' is the name of the language. |
| # |
| # It should also provide rules for: |
| # |
| # - making any compiler driver (eg: g++) |
| # - the compiler proper (eg: cc1plus) |
| # - define the names for selecting the language in LANGUAGES. |
| # |
